A Fulton Georgia Motion for Leave to File Third Party Complaint is a legal document requesting permission from the court to add a third party to a lawsuit. This motion is typically filed by defendants who believe that another party may be responsible for all or part of the plaintiff's claims against them. By filing a third-party complaint, the defendant seeks to shift some or all of the liability to the new party. There are different types of Motion for Leave to File Third Party Complaint that can be filed in Fulton Georgia courts, each depending on the specific circumstances of the case. Some common types include: 1. Indemnification Third-Party Complaint: This motion is filed when the defendant believes that a third party has agreed to indemnify or assume responsibility for any damages or losses incurred in the lawsuit. 2. Contribution Third-Party Complaint: This motion is filed when the defendant believes that the third party should share in the responsibility for the plaintiff's claims based on their own fault or negligence. 3. Contractual Liability Third-Party Complaint: This motion is filed when the defendant argues that a third party, based on a contractual agreement, is responsible for any damages or losses caused by the defendant. 4. Vicarious Liability Third-Party Complaint: This motion is filed when the defendant claims that a third party should be held accountable for the actions of the defendant under the concept of vicarious liability, such as an employer being responsible for the actions of their employee. When preparing a Fulton Georgia Motion for Leave to File Third Party Complaint, it is crucial to provide all relevant factual details and legal arguments supporting the need to add the third party. This includes showing how the third party's involvement is necessary for a fair and complete resolution of the case and how it aligns with the state's laws and rules of civil procedure. Effective drafting and persuasive language can significantly increase the chances of obtaining the court's permission for filing the third-party complaint.
